CC-373 ac-u-c-2-21 (atpB deletion) mt+

$30.00

Hurley Shepherd in Boynton-Gillham laboratory, Duke University, 1979

Phenotype: requires acetate

ac-u-c-2-21 is a deletion mutation in the chloroplast atpB gene. CC-373 is a clean, non-reverting acetate-requiring mutant, and has been widely used as a recipient for chloroplast transformation experiments. For the same mutation in mt-, see CC-728.


Shepherd HS, Boynton JE, Gillham NW (1979) Mutations in nine chloroplast loci of Chlamydomonas affecting different photosynthetic functions. Proc Natl Acad Sci USA 76:1353-1357

Myers AM, Grant DM, Rabert DK, Harris EH, Boynton JE, Gillham NW (1982) Mutants of Chlamydomonas reinhardtii with physical alterations in their chloroplast DNA. Plasmid 7:133-151

Woessner JP, Masson A, Harris EH, Bennoun P, Gillham NW, Boynton JE (1984) Molecular and genetic analysis of the chloroplast ATPase of chlamydomonas. Plant Mol Biol 3:177-190

Boynton JE, Gillham NW, Harris EH, Hosler JP, Johnson AM, Jones AR, Randolph-Anderson BL, Robertson D, Klein TM, Shark KB (1988) Chloroplast transformation in Chlamydomonas with high velocity microprojectiles. Science 240:1534-1538
